Up World Masters Athletics Championships 2015, Lyon - 4x400m finals etc, Sunday 17 August, Duchere Stadium Prev Next Slideshow

 Previous image  Next image  Index page
_MMP2592
_MMP2594
_MMP2596
_MMP2598
_MMP2601
  _MMP2604.jpg  
_MMP2608
_MMP2609
_MMP2611
_MMP2618
_MMP2622

MMP2604
Total images: 262 | Help